#f59128 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f59128 is composed of 96.1% red, 56.9%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 40.8% magenta, 83.7%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 30.7 degrees, a saturation of 91.1% and a lightness of 55.9%. #f59128 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ff50 with #eb2300. Closest websafe color is: #ff9933.

#f59128 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f59128 has RGB values of R:245, G:145,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.41, Y:0.84,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16093480.

Shades and Tints of #f59128
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0500 is the darkest color, while #fffaf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f59128
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#968f87 is the less saturated color, while #fe911f is the most saturated one.
